#04ced4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#04ced4 is composed of 1.6% red, 80.8% green and 83.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 98.1% cyan, 2.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 181.7 degrees, a saturation of 96.3% and a lightness of 42.4%. #04ced4 color hex could be obtained by blending #08ffff with #009da9. Closest websafe color is: #00cccc.

Shades and Tints of #04ced4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#ecfeff is the lightest one.
